Achillea phrygia

Achillea phrygia

 Özge civanperçemi

Height 10-40 cm. Stems terete, obtuse-angled, woolly with dense indumentum of long spreading hairs. Leaves with dense spreading hairs, linear, median cauline 1,5-4 x 0,15-0,3 cm, pinnatisect, segments densely imbricate, 1-1.5mm, 3-lobed, lobes broadly ovate to oblong, denticulate. Capitula 8-40, corymbs 2-8 cm broad, peduncles absent or up to 5 mm. Involucre ovoid-oblong, 5.5-6 x 3-4 mm. Phyllaries ovate to oblong and lanceolate, obtuse, densely spreading woolly, with greenish midrib and broad pellucid margins. Ligules 2-4, golden yellow , 2-3 mm; disc flowers 10-25. Fl. 5-7. Steppes, limestone slopes, Quercetum, 700-1500 m.
Endemic. Ir.-Tur. element. Closely allied to A. gypsicola.
